读书人

DBChart怎么能随着数据变动而刷新

发布时间: 2012-12-31 11:57:52 作者: rapoo

DBChart如何能随着数据变动而刷新?
用下面这些代码:


DBChart1->RefreshData();
Series1->XLabelsSource="";
Series2->XLabelsSource="";
Series1->YValues->ValueSource="";
Series2->YValues->ValueSource=""; //初始化DBChart1
ADOQChart->Close();
ADOQChart->Open();
Series1->DataSource=ADOQChart;
Series2->DataSource=ADOQChart;
Series1->XLabelsSource=ADOQChart->Fields->Fields[0]->FieldName;
Series2->XLabelsSource=ADOQChart->Fields->Fields[0]->FieldName;
Series1->YValues->ValueSource=ADOQChart->Fields->Fields[1]->FieldName;
Series2->YValues->ValueSource=ADOQChart->Fields->Fields[2]->FieldName;
Screen->Cursor=crDefault;

如果手工刷新没有问题,但如果想让它自动刷新要怎么设置?我把它放进ADOQChartAfterScroll事件中去,但不能成功。
[解决办法]
搞定了。结贴。给分吧

读书人网 >C++ Builder

热点推荐